- The distance between Gabo Island, Australia and Latina, Italy is approximately 16,341 km or 10,154 mi.
- To reach Gabo Island in this distance one would set out from Latina bearing 97.6°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Gabo Island bearing 110.6° or ESE .
- Gabo Island has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Latina has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Both are in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 0.4 °C (0.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.6 °C (13.7°F) less in Gabo Island.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 34.1 mm (1.3 in) more which is equivalent to 34.1 l/m² (0.84 US gal/ft²) or 341,000 l/ha (36,455 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.2° higher in Gabo Island than in Latina.
